Edit: didn’t find data about spendings but found some stats

Ukrainian refugees actually boosted Poland’s GDP by approximately 2.7% in 2024, adding an estimated €16 billionin economic output IntelliNews UNHCR Reuters .

 They contributed around PLN 15.21 billion (~$4 billion) in tax revenues in 2024, compared to about PLN 2.8 billion in benefits received via the “800+” child allowance — meaning roughly for every 1 zloty in benefits, they paid about 5.4 zlotys in taxes/social contributions
